We are looking for a Workshop Assistant to join our Workshop Team.

To be successful, you will need some experience in an engineering or mechanical environment, a full UK driving licence, a good understanding of health and safety, and skills in using mechanical hand tools. Most importantly you must have an interest in mechanics and be eager to learn new skills.

In this varied role, where no two days will be the same, you will report to the Workshop Manager and focus on assisting the workshop team with the running of the workshop, which includes repair and maintenance of various types of medium to heavy plant, such as 360 excavators, grabs, loading shovels, dumpers, HGV’s, telehandlers and crushers.
